**Job Title:** Food Safety Quality Control Technician

 

**Job Description:**

 

Join our rapidly growing team as a Food Safety Quality Control Technician, where you’ll play a crucial role in ensuring the quality and safety of our products in a fast-paced manufacturing environment. Our company is experiencing massive growth, and we are looking for dedicated individuals who thrive under pressure and have a genuine passion for the food industry.

 

Responsibilities:

 

- Conduct pre-start checks for all production lines, ensuring equipment and processes meet safety and quality standards.

- Perform hourly inspections throughout the production process to maintain quality control.

- Document findings meticulously and contribute to comprehensive post-production reports.

- Train team members on quality assurance practices and procedures for consistency and compliance.

-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to address and resolve quality-related issues promptly.

- Maintain quality standards by approving incoming materials, in-process production, and finished products; recording quality results.

- Ensure comp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and SQF (Safe Quality Food) standards.

- Monitor critical control points and make corrections to prevent deviations.

- Perform and document regular audits of processes, procedures, and quality systems.

- Manage corrective actions and ensure timely resolution of quality issues.

- Train and support production staff on quality control measures.

- Oversee sanitation processes to maintain a hygienic manufacturing environment.

 

Qualifications:

 

- Prior experience in quality assurance within the food industry is essential.

- Strong understanding of food safety regulations and best practices.

- Ability to work in a high-pressure environment while maintaining attention to detail.

- Passion for food and manufacturing, with a commitment to product excellence.

- Minimum 3 years of experience in a food quality technician position.

- Proven experience working with GMP and SQF certified facilities.

- Strong background in regulatory compliance and food safety.

- Exceptional documentation skills with high attention to detail.

- Understanding of sanitation processes within the food industry.
